She has appeared on Celebrity Ex On The Beach and Celebs Go Dating, but Helen Flanagan says she will keep her next relationship private.
The actress, 35, believes her next boyfriend will be 'The One' and expressed her hopes she will soon marry.
In a new interview with podcaster Lewis Nicholls' Life Stories, Helen reflected on how her turbulent love life hasn't made her lose hope of finding her perfect match.
Helen, who split from former non-league footballer Robbie Talbot, 45, last year, said: 'I don't really date anyone. I find it quite difficult to meet people because I really want someone to love me for me.
'I am a romantic and know I will have my happy ever after. I do know I'm going to find my one.'
Helen said she finds it hard because she 'does get recognised' when she's out and wants to find a partner who will get to know her away from her public profile.

She continued: 'I do feel when I have my next relationship, I think it will be my husband. I will choose to protect it and be more private.
'I will probably say who that person is but I will want to protect it and keep it really special. I feel like everybody always has something to say.
'My ex-boyfriend was on Celebs Go Dating which was kind of iconic but I kind of just feel as well like I've learned a lot. I'm 35 and I've just learned like a lot. I feel like when I do actually find my one or my husband, you know, I really will have worked hard for my happiness.'
In March, Helen declared she would never date a footballer again amid her feud with her ex-fiance, Scott Sinclair.
The exes have been at loggerheads since they broke up in 2022 after 13 years together. They share children Matilda, 10, Delilah, seven, and son Charlie, four, and have been co-parenting for the last four years since splitting.
The actress previously told the Daily Mail how she keeps her love life 'very separate' to her children as she is 'very protective' of them.
She said: 'I keep my love life like very separate, my children are so precious.

'It would take a lot for me to introduce anyone to my children, because they're like that's so precious, it would have to be really right and a very sensible male, yeah.'
Elsewhere in the chat, Helen insisted she is sick of 'shrinking herself and toning things down' for men as she revealed what she is looking for in a relationship.
'I feel like I've had to shrink myself sometimes', she said. 'I think it's a really lovely feeling when you're with a man and you feel like I can really be myself here and they think I'm great, they think I'm really funny and I don't have to tone myself down.'
The mother-of-three insisted she never tries to force a connection with a man as she has found the 'connection is either there or not'.
Earlier this year, Helen laid bare the depth of her feelings for David Haye, 45, in her autobiography Head & Heart, admitting she fell 'deeply in love' with the former world champion, though their romance proved complicated.
Helen and David, who she first met when they both appeared on I'm A Celebrity... Get Me Out Of Here! in 2012, enjoyed a brief romance after her split from Scott.
They crossed paths again when Helen bumped into David at an awards ceremony in autumn 2022, before he later reached out after seeing a lingerie shoot she had done for Ann Summers.
